Bus station hiking trails around Geeste offer access to a diverse landscape in Emsland, Germany. The region is characterized by its position along the Ems River, featuring picturesque riverine scenery and accessible gentle hills. Hikers can explore forested areas and expansive moorlands, providing varied terrain for outdoor activities. The Geeste Reservoir also contributes to the natural features of the area.

There are over 80 hiking trails around Geeste that are accessible from bus stations, offering a wide range of options for different preferences and fitness levels.
Spring and autumn are ideal seasons for hiking around Geeste. The weather is mild, and the natural landscapes, especially the colorful autumnal foliage, are particularly stunning. The Geester Water Kingdom – Moorland Trails offers beautiful scenery during these times.
Yes, Geeste offers many easy hiking trails accessible by bus. Out of the 80 available routes, 56 are classified as easy, making them suitable for casual walkers or those looking for a relaxed outing. An example is the Geestmoor – Moorland Trails, which is an easy 6.3 km loop.
The hiking trails around Geeste are highly rated by the komoot community, with an average score of 4.57 out of 5 stars from over 4,500 ratings. Hikers often praise the diverse landscapes, from riverine scenery to moorland, and the accessibility of the routes from public transport.
Yes, Geeste is known for its family-friendly options. The region features trails like the 'Adventure Trail' (mentioned in region research), which winds through forests with play stations for children. While specific bus stops for this trail aren't listed, many easy routes are suitable for families.
Many trails in the Geeste region are dog-friendly, allowing you to enjoy the natural beauty with your canine companion. It's always recommended to keep dogs on a leash, especially in nature reserves or near livestock, and to check local regulations for specific areas.
Yes, many of the bus-accessible hiking trails around Geeste are circular routes, offering convenient starting and ending points. For example, the Heathland Remnant in Varloh – Landcafé Alte Scheune loop is a moderate circular hike.
Geeste offers a diverse range of landscapes. You can expect picturesque views along the Ems River, gentle hilly terrain with panoramic vistas, forested sections, and unique moorland areas. The Ems River Bend Near Wachendorf trail showcases the beautiful river scenery.
Along the trails, you can discover several natural and cultural highlights. The Geeste Reservoir North Beach, Geeste Reservoir East Shore, and Geeste Reservoir (West Side) offer beautiful lakeside views. You might also encounter charming huts like the Thatched Shelter by the Lake or the Rühler Milk and Egg Hut.
There are options for refreshments near some trails. For instance, the Restaurant Deichkrone at the Geeste Reservoir offers a place to eat with scenic views. Additionally, the Diekamps Fietzenstop is a convenient stop for cyclists and hikers.
Yes, for experienced hikers seeking a challenge, there are 3 difficult routes available. One such option is the Ems River Bend Near Wachendorf – Emshöhenweg loop, which is a demanding 27.8 km hike with notable elevation changes.
